## What You'll Do
As a Software Engineer III at Sigmatech, you will:
- Build secure, scalable, user?focused applications using modern engineering practices.
- Collaborate daily with designers, product leads, and mission partners to deliver high?value features.
- Champion practices such as DevSecOps, continuous integration, automated testing, and cloud?native delivery.
- Help customers adopt modern software delivery approaches and guide them through technical decision?making.
- Participate in pair programming, code reviews, architecture discussions, and iterative planning.
- Continuously refine your skills and contribute to a culture of knowledge sharing and improvement.
- Communicate technical decisions clearly while tailoring your message to diverse stakeholders.
- Ensure solutions meet mission, security, and performance requirements while maintaining rapid delivery momentum.
Experience and Skills:
## Required Qualifications
- 5-8+ years of professional software engineering experience.
- Experience developing in one or more modern languages (e.g., C#, Typescript, Python, Go).
- Experience building and deploying applications using c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or similar).
- Strong understanding of testing practices, automated pipelines, and secure coding principles.
- Experience working closely with users, product teams, or customer stakeholders.
- Ability to work in a collaborative, iterative environment (Agile/Lean methodologies).
- U.S. citizenship required; ability to obtain and maintain a security clearance (if not already cleared).
